Defining Cosmetology

esthetics facial toners in New Pine Creek OR salonCosmetology is a profession that is everything about making the human body look more attractive through the application of cosmetics. So of course it makes sense that many cosmetology schools are regarded as beauty schools. Many of us think of makeup when we hear the term cosmetics, but actually a cosmetic can be almost anything that improves the look of a person’s skin, hair or nails. In order to work as a cosmetologist, the majority of states require that you take some type of specialized training and then become licensed. Once licensed, the work settings include not only New Pine Creek OR beauty salons and barber shops, but also such venues as spas, hotels and resorts. Many cosmetologists, after they have gotten experience and a clientele, establish their own shops or salons. Others will start seeing customers either in their own residences or will go to the client’s residence, or both. Cosmetology college graduates have many professional names and work in a wide variety of specialties including:

  • Estheticians
  • Hairdressers
  • Hairstylists
  • Beauticians
  • Barbers
  • Manicurists
  • Nail Technicians
  • Makeup Artists
  • Hair Coloring Specialists
  • Electrolysis Technicians

As earlier stated, in most states practicing cosmetologists must be licensed. In a few states there is an exemption. Only those performing more skilled services, for example hairstylists, are required to be licensed. Others working in cosmetology and less skilled, such as shampooers, are not required to be licensed in those states.

Esthetics Certificates and Degrees

cucumber mask New Pine Creek OR esthetics clientThere are primarily two avenues available to obtain esthetician training and a credential upon completion. You can enroll in a certificate (or diploma) program, or you can work toward an Associate’s degree. Certificate programs typically call for 12 to 18 months to complete, while an Associate’s degree usually takes about 2 years. If you enroll in a certificate program you will be trained in all of the main areas of cosmetology. Briefer programs are offered if you want to concentrate on just one area, for instance esthetics. A degree program will also probably incorporate management and marketing training to ensure that graduates are better prepared to run a parlor or other New Pine Creek OR business. Higher degrees are not common, but Bachelor and Master’s degree programs are offered in such specializations as salon or spa management. Whatever type of program you decide on, it’s essential to make certain that it’s approved by the Oregon Board of Cosmetology. Many states only approve schools that are accredited by certain reputable agencies, including the American Association of Cosmetology Schools (AACS). Online Esthetics Training

Online esthetician programs are accommodating for New Pine Creek OR students who are employed full time and have family obligations that make it hard to attend a more traditional school. There are many online cosmetology school programs available that can be attended by means of a personal computer or laptop at the student’s convenience. More conventional beauty schools are often fast paced given that many programs are as brief as 6 or 8 months. This means that a considerable amount of time is spent in the classroom. With internet programs, you are dealing with the same amount of material, but you’re not spending numerous hours outside of your home or commuting to and from classes. On the other hand, it’s vital that the training program you select can provide internship training in local salons and parlors so that you also receive the hands-on training required for a comprehensive education. Without the internship portion of the training, it’s impossible to obtain the skills required to work in any area of the cosmetology field. So make sure if you decide to enroll in an online program to verify that internship training is available in your area.

Is the Program Accredited? It’s necessary to make sure that the esthetician school you select is accredited. The accreditation should be by a U.S. Department of Education acknowledged local or national organization, such as the National Accrediting Commission for Cosmetology Arts & Sciences (NACCAS). Schools accredited by the NACCAS must meet their high standards assuring a superior curriculum and education. Accreditation can also be important for getting student loans or financial aid, which often are not available in 97635 for non- accredited schools. It’s also a prerequisite for licensing in many states that the training be accredited. And as a concluding benefit, many New Pine Creek OR employers will not hire recent graduates of non-accredited schools, or might look more favorably upon those with accredited training.

Does the School have a Great Reputation?  Any esthetician college that you are seriously considering should have a good to outstanding reputation within the field. Being accredited is a good starting point. Next, ask the schools for references from their network of businesses where they have referred their students. Check that the schools have high job placement rates, signifying that their students are highly demanded. Check rating companies for reviews in addition to the school’s accrediting organizations. If you have any relationships with New Pine Creek OR salon owners or managers, or someone working in the field, ask them if they are familiar with the schools you are considering. They may even be able to suggest others that you had not considered. Finally, contact the Oregon school licensing authority to see if there have been any grievances filed or if the schools are in complete compliance.

What’s the School’s Specialty?  Many esthetician schools offer programs that are expansive in nature, focusing on all facets of cosmetology. Others are more focused, providing training in a specific specialty, such as hairstyling, manicuring or electrolysis. Schools that offer degree programs often expand into a management and marketing curriculum. So it’s important that you select a school that focuses on your area of interest. If your goal is to be trained as an esthetician, make sure that the school you enroll in is accredited and well regarded for that program. If your dream is to launch a New Pine Creek OR beauty salon, then you need to enroll in a degree program that will teach you how to be an owner/operator. Picking a highly regarded school with a weak program in the specialty you are seeking will not deliver the training you need.

Is Plenty of Live Training Provided?  Learning and perfecting esthetician skills and techniques demands plenty of practice on volunteers. Find out how much live, hands-on training is provided in the beauty courses you will be attending. Some schools have salons on site that enable students to practice their growing talents on real people. If a beauty program offers minimal or no scheduled live training, but rather relies predominantly on the use of mannequins, it may not be the best option for cultivating your skills. Therefore look for other schools that offer this type of training.

Does the School Provide Job Assistance?  As soon as a student graduates from an esthetician academy, it’s essential that she or he receives help in securing that first job. Job placement programs are an integral part of that process. Schools that provide assistance maintain relationships with New Pine Creek OR employers that are seeking skilled graduates available for hiring. Verify that the programs you are considering have job placement programs and inquire which salons and organizations they refer students to. In addition, find out what their job placement rates are. High rates not only verify that they have wide networks of employers, but that their programs are highly respected as well.

Is Financial Assistance Available?  Almost all esthetician schools provide financial aid or student loan assistance for their students. Find out if the schools you are reviewing have a financial aid office. Talk to a counselor and find out what student loans or grants you may qualify for. If the school is a member of the American Association of Cosmetology Schools (AACS), it will have scholarships accessible to students also. If a school satisfies all of your other qualifications except for expense, do not discard it as an option before you learn what financial aid may be available.
